Liverpool team news: Injury, suspension list vs. Brentford

Sports Mole rounds up all of Liverpool's latest injury and suspension news ahead of their Premier League clash with Brentford.

Liverpool will return to Premier League action on Sunday afternoon, with Brentford making the trip to Anfield.

The Reds will enter the contest off the back of a goalless draw with Arsenal in the first leg of their EFL Cup semi-final at Anfield on Thursday night.

Jurgen Klopp's side are currently third in the Premier League table, boasting 42 points from their 20 matches, which has left them 11 points behind leaders Manchester City.

Here, Sports Mole rounds up all of Liverpool's latest injury and suspension news ahead of the contest with Brentford, who currently sit 13th in England's top flight.

Liverpool remain without central defender Nat Phillips due to the fractured cheekbone that he suffered against AC Milan in the Champions League.

Harvey Elliott is making excellent progress in his recovery from a serious ankle injury, but the youngster will not be able to return to the field for some time yet.

Experienced midfielder Thiago Alcantara is currently struggling to overcome a hip problem, which will rule the Spain international out of action for the foreseeable future.
